Remdesivir, also known as GS-5734, is a prodrug form of the antiviral nucleoside analog GS-44152. Upon entry into cells, remdesivir is metabolized into the nucleotide triphosphate GS-441524. Remdesivir inhibits murine hepatitis virus (MHV) with an EC50 of 30 nM, and blocks SARS-CoV and MERS-CoV in HAE cells with EC50s of both 74 nM in HAE cells after treatment for 24 h. GS-5734 inhibits both epidemic and zoonotic coronaviruses. It was developed as a treatment for filovirus infections such as Ebola virus disease and Marburg virus. Remdesivir was approved for treatment of COVID-19.
